Summary
Ants Laur is a human[1]. He was born in Saksi Rural Municipality[2]. He was born on +1899-06-27T00:00:00Z[3]. He died in Oakville[4]. He died on +1996-03-05T00:00:00Z[5]. He worked as an Esperantist[6] and chemist[7].
